- who: Li Wang from the (UNIVERSITY) have published the paper: Gut-on-a-chip for exploring the transport mechanism of Hg(II), in the Journal: (JOURNAL)
- what: The decrease in ZO-1 protein expression was the main reason for the decrease in TEER.
- how: To determine whether fluid flow and mechanical strain alter cytodifferentiation the authors analyzed the catalytic activity of alkaline phosphatase (AKP) in Caco-2 cells.
